Chevrolet Models Covered & Key Technical Specifications

Models: Chevrolet Colorado
Sub-models / Variants: 4WD, Pickup
Trade Names: Canyon
Model Years: 2008–2010
Technical Data:

  • Transfer case mounting bolt torque: 50 N·m (37 lb ft)
  • Transfer case speed sensor torque: 17 N·m (13 lb ft)
  • Transfer case NEUTRAL switch torque: 39 N·m (29 lb ft)
  • Encoder motor mounting bolt torque: 22 N·m (16 lb ft)
  • Pickup box to frame rail bolt torque: 85 N·m (63 lb ft)
  • Front output shaft yoke flange nut torque: 137 N·m (101 lb ft)

Driveline and Brake System Documentation

The manual thoroughly details the Isuzu T150 transfer case, mapping out internal components such as the planetary carrier, drive chain, and synchronizer assemblies. Technical sections outline the exact component locations needed for transfer case replacement, front and rear output shaft seal swaps, and encoder motor diagnostics. Coverage of the antilock brake system (ABS) is comprehensive. It catalogs the brake pressure modulator valve, electronic brake control module, and speed sensor placements. Additional diagrams map out the longitudinal accelerometer, yaw rate sensor, and traction control switches. This level of detail significantly speeds up component identification and streamlines diagnostic workflows in a busy shop environment.

Specification Highlights

Accurate fastener torque values are essential for maintaining the structural integrity of this pickup. The documentation lists these figures in both Metric and US units. For example, brake pipe fittings at the BPMV inlet are specified at 32 N·m (24 lb ft). Front wheel speed sensor bolts require 8 N·m (71 lb in), while pickup box to frame rail bolts must be tightened to 85 N·m (63 lb ft) according to the structural repair specifications.
